2010 Fundraising Boxing Night : Monday 1st March 2010

H. G. Wells Suite The 33rd Annual Charity Dinner and Boxing Night
run by the Rotary Club of Guildford District,
was held at the HG Wells Centre in Woking on Monday 1st March 2010.

The evening proved a great success raising in excess of £20k for deserving causes.

Among our guests were the Mayor of Woking, Councillor Tina Liddington,
Jimmy Floyd Hasselbank, past Dutch International and Chelsea footballer
Colbornes Garages our Sponsors and Rotary Dignitaries.

The usual format was followed where over 260 patrons

enjoyed a fine dinner, good company,

a high roller game of Heads and Tails,

grand raffle, quality boxing, and charity auction.

The standard of the boxing this year was first class with

8 exciting bouts taking place under the direction of the ABA

all arranged by the, Guildford City ABC

featuring some of their most promising boxers

in keen competion from other clubs.

Through the past 33 years, over 500 hundred charities
have benefited and over half a million pounds distributed.

The two Principal beneficiaries this year are:
Chase Hospice Care for Children
and a further Arusha Children's Education Project.
